

“Sis” was the wife of former mayor of Sulphur, Adias “Be’be’” Saunier. She was born in Slagle, Louisiana to Amos and Edna Owens. She was a faithful member of The First Pentecostal Church of Sulphur. Sis was a loving wife, mother, and Grandmother/Granny.
